This image displays the Chi Rho (☧) Christogram, formed by superimposing the Greek letters Chi (Χ) and Rho (Ρ), representing “Christos.” Flanking the central cross are Alpha (Α) at the top and Omega (Ω) at the bottom, signifying Christ as the beginning and the end (Revelation 22:13). The design is historically rooted in Constantine’s vision and widely used in liturgical art, manuscripts, and ecclesiastical insignia.
